RL – Reporting Level means the level to which the laboratory reported the presence of an analyte. For radionuclides, Reporting Level is the MDA95.

DLR – Detection Limit for purposes of Reporting (DLR) means the designated minimum level at or above which any analytical finding of a contaminant in drinking water resulting from monitoring required under Chapter 15 of Title 22 shall be reported to the State Board (California Code of Regulations Section § 64400.34)
